资源简介
很不错的一个国外学者写得NSGA-II_matlab库
代码片段和文件信息
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
% MATLAB Code for %
% %
% Non-dominated Sorting Genetic Algorithm II (NSGA-II) %
% Version 1.0 - April 2010 %
% %
% Programmed By: S. Mostapha Kalami Heris %
% %
% e-Mail: sm.kalami@gmail.com %
% kalami@ee.kntu.ac.ir %
% %
% Homepage: http://www.kalami.ir %
% %
% BinaryTournamentSelection.m : implelemnts binary tournament %
% selection %
% %
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
function p=BinaryTournamentSelection(pop)
npop=numel(pop);
i=randint(12[1 npop]);
p1=pop(i(1));
p2=pop(i(2));
if p1.Rank < p2.Rank
p=p1;
elseif p1.Rank > p2.Rank
p=p2;
else
if p1.CrowdingDistance>p2.CrowdingDistance
p=p1;
else
p=p2;
end
end
end
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2010-04-26 01:16 NSGA-II\
文件 1521 2010-04-26 00:05 NSGA-II\BinaryTournamentSelection.m
文件 1637 2010-04-26 00:06 NSGA-II\CalcCrowdingDistance.m
文件 1242 2010-04-26 00:07 NSGA-II\Cost.m
文件 1462 2010-04-26 00:08 NSGA-II\CreateEmptyIndividuals.m
文件 1357 2010-04-26 00:09 NSGA-II\Crossover.m
文件 1244 2010-04-26 00:10 NSGA-II\Dominates.m
文件 1187 2010-04-26 00:11 NSGA-II\GetCosts.m
文件 1317 2010-04-26 01:13 NSGA-II\Mutate.m
文件 2488 2010-04-26 00:12 NSGA-II\NonDominatedSorting.m
文件 3140 2010-04-26 01:13 NSGA-II\nsga2.m
文件 1645 2010-04-26 00:14 NSGA-II\PlotFronts.m
文件 1442 2010-04-26 00:16 NSGA-II\SortPopulation.m
文件 110 2010-04-26 01:16 NSGA-II\www.kalami.ir.url
- 上一篇:涡格法计算气动力MATLAB
- 下一篇:计算两幅图像的psnr值matlab
相关资源
- 计算两幅图像的psnr值matlab
- 涡格法计算气动力MATLAB
- 无刷直流电机MATLAB仿真模型
- matlab实现灰度图的jpeg编码过程
- bfgs算法-matlab源程序
- 边界元法的MATLAB程序
- 解决灾情巡视TSP问题数模的MATLAB程序
- NLMS程序代码_matlab
- OFDM通信系统的Matlab仿真 源程序 m文件
- PCM_FSK_ASK_DPSK仿真源码(matlab实现)
- 移动最小二乘法计算程序
- 泽尼克多项式表达式计算
- matlab下进行的凸轮轮廓线的设计
- 讲DPM的MATLAB模型保存为txt
- MATLAB遗传算法工具箱
-
MATLABSimuli
nk与Modelsim联合仿真步骤及 - MATLAB多视点图像合成GUI
- c均值算法matlab实现
- 基于matlab程序的汉字识别
- DFA(Detrended fluctuation analysis) matlab
- matlab 物体碰撞模型论文
- 基于matlab设计DOE元件的GS算法源代码
- 基于MIMO的信号检测算法仿真程序
- 球杆系统 模糊控制 matlab实际控制
- MATLAB 2017 深度学习 车辆检测 R_CNN
- Bursa_Wolf,布尔莎坐标转换,matlab,平
- matlab实现亚像素
- 非下采样Contourlet变换工具包 nsct_too
- 双音多频Goertzel算法Matlab仿真
- Matlab小波图像处理+完整程序
评论
共有 条评论